SHILLONG: Amid the continuing onslaught of the COVID-19 pandemic, the Shillong Khasi Jaintia Church Leaders Forum (SKJCLF) has appealed to all believers to participate in a day of united prayers and fasting for God’s healing on Sunday between 6 am to 6 pm.
A special service will be telecast in local cable channels at 7 pm. At any time during the day, believers, groups and churches may participate in this programme by offering prayers for God’s mercy and healing in unity with all participants across our land. For believers who have a conviction to fast and pray, one may also observe fasting at their own convenience, a statement from the SKJCLF said.
